Girlfriend Rescue is an indie action RPG that blends turn-based exploration and combat with real-time beat 'em up influences on PC. Players control a customizable party in a modern setting, racing against time to locate and rescue a kidnapped girlfriend while battling enemies through a combination of strategic party management and direct confrontation.
Gameplay
The core loop centers on visible encounters that allow players to choose when to engage foes rather than relying on random battles. Combat mixes traditional RPG elements with beat 'em up pacing, where character selection and skill combinations determine outcomes. Each of the nine base characters plus four secret unlockables brings unique spells and abilities, such as Martin's speed-focused moves, Lester's commanding presence, Joy's supportive role, Katia's unconventional tricks, and Cookie's venom-based attacks.
Exploration rewards thorough searching across worlds, with items, weapons, and equipment scattered throughout. Status ailments add layers of strategy, forcing players to manage party health and avoid conditions like starvation or illness. Stat-boosting items apply immediately for quick gains, and the rename feature lets players personalize the entire cast with real names for added immersion. Auto-save and optional mouse controls streamline sessions, while 14 bonus items unlock after completing each world.
Game Modes
Six difficulty settings shape the experience, ranging from Easy for initial runs to more punishing options like Rogue, Maniac, and Legendary. These modes alter enemy strength, resource availability, and overall challenge without changing core mechanics. Visible encounters remain consistent across difficulties, giving players control over pacing and engagement.
Rogue mode emphasizes careful planning due to its heightened risks, while Legendary pushes strategic depth with tougher status effects and limited recovery options. The variety supports multiple playthroughs, especially when combined with different party compositions drawn from the full roster of characters.
Progression and Customization
Players advance by defeating enemies for experience, unlocking new skills and equipment that enhance party versatility. Creative spell use and item management form the backbone of success, with 50 achievements tracking milestones like world completion and secret discoveries. The system encourages experimentation across parties, as each character's distinct toolkit opens fresh tactical approaches on repeat runs.
Bonus items from world clears provide lasting upgrades, and the modern-world setting keeps the focus on direct objectives rather than sprawling lore. Exploration ties directly into combat readiness, as hidden resources help counter the time pressure of the central rescue mission.
